Biography

When business partnerships, startups, and investment funds are in the throes of intra-company disputes or face claims of wrongdoing, business litigator John D. Pernick guides companies and their founders, directors, executives, and investors toward resolutions that serve their overall interests, be it through negotiation or litigation. He also represents companies and individuals in complex state and federal litigation matters and in connection with investigations by the Securities Exchange Commission (SEC),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A), U.S. Department of Justice (DOJ), and other regulatory agencies and authorities.

Business Breakups and Complex Disputes

John has more than 25 years of experience representing a range of clients, from Silicon Valley and Bay Area startups to Fortune 50 corporations, in complex business litigation in state and federal courts.

John leverages his background in corporate governance and corporate control fights to add expediency and efficiency to the litigation process. He aims to lessen the burden and disruption of litigation for emerging and growth companies while still obtaining optimal results.

John’s clients include a cross-section of Silicon Valley’s technology, software, and financial companies as well as manufacturers, online retailers and participants in emerging industries, such as cryptocurrency and cannabis.

In building a client’s case, John digs deep into underlying business issues. He examines what should have happened to make the business prosper and actions, governance practices, and structural deficiencies that led to the dispute.

His representative experience includes defending venture capital firms and their partners in actions claiming breach of fiduciary duties in connection with portfolio company refinancings. He has also led tech company CEOs in company and shareholder disputes, and he has steered Chief Compliance Officers in proceedings before the DOJ,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ation, and other agencies.
